Morning all

wash my car regularly but this morning on every flat surface ie , bonnet door handles tops of wings roof top of bumper etc my car is covered in thousands of orange spots you can  feel them it’s tough to touch won’t wash of 

carnt understand where it’s from ? 
Any help would be much appreciated

Yoy need some fall out remover. Wash car, spray fall out remover on... let it turn purple.. wash off the. Repeat a couple times. Tgat should sort it..

My Wife used to get similar when her office car park was immediately underneath overhead pylon cables.  More noticeable in damp conditions.  Used to come off with a hot wash and elbow grease.  Fallout remover and a clay bar worked for the really stubborn bits.
